Lavender Essential Oil

Lavender essential oil is a gentle and effective option for soothing growing pains in kids due to its calming and anti-inflammatory properties.
To use, dilute a few drops with a carrier oil and massage it gently onto your child’s legs before bedtime.
This can help relax their muscles and provide comfort, making it easier for them to fall asleep.
Roman Chamomile Essential Oil
Roman chamomile essential oil is well-known for its soothing effects and can help alleviate growing pains.
Mix a few drops with a carrier oil and rub it gently onto your child’s sore areas, especially before they go to sleep or after a warm bath.
The calming scent also promotes relaxation and better sleep.
